This is a wonderful energy technique which , one of many originated by Paul E Dennison and Gail E Dennison in their Edu-Kinesthetics Learning-Through-Movement Series, or better known as – Brain Gym ®
Drawing the Lazy 8 – or infinity symbol – enables the reader to cross the visual midline without interruption, thus activating both right and left eyes and integrating the right and left visual fields.
This exercise helps with:
relaxation of the eyes, neck and shoulders while focussing
improved depth perception
improved centring, balance and co-ordination.

This exercise can be done in several ways:
1. Extend one arm straight out in front of you with the thumb pointed upwards to the ceiling, Focussing your eyes on your thumb ‘air draw’ a figure of 8 with your thumb. Do 3 full figure 8, then change to the other hand and repeat the process. Then place both hands together and focussing on both thumbs, repeat the process
2. Point your right arm out in front of you, at shoulder height. Now turn your head towards that arm and connect your nose with you upper arm – as in an elephant trunk shape. Now looking along your extended arm, ‘air weave’ a figure of 8 with your arm. Do this 3 times. Change arms and repeat the process.
3. With a crayon or pencil or piece of chalk in your right hand, draw a very large figure 8 or infinity sign on a large piece of paper or the black/chalk board keeping your attention on the crayon or pencil or chalk. Do this 3 times. Now change hands and repeat the process. Now keeping both hands together and holding the crayon or pencil or chalk in both your hands, repeat the process again.
4. Holding a streamer on a stick in front of you with your right hand, simply wave a figure of 8 or the infinity sign in front of you 3 times. Change hands and repeat the process. Now hold the streamer in both hands and repeat it again.
